Transaction 53280517f9677c339a4986450117a43c83e7a2ca19b8caa6ae9359c697c00f7e

1 Input
2 Outputs
  • 53280517f9677c339a4986450117a43c83e7a2ca19b8caa6ae9359c697c00f7e:0
  • value  6110511
    address  3FTCfarwFsgpJXJ4mgpwjK5n5hs8Rd9mwJ
  • 53280517f9677c339a4986450117a43c83e7a2ca19b8caa6ae9359c697c00f7e:1
  • value  241200
    address  17XvGfVDSeSUrVL3HkLgCasyFJF59HY2gF